# Engine Arguments
Engine arguments control the behavior of the vLLM engine.
@@ -5,11 +9,12 @@ Engine arguments control the behavior of the vLLM engine.
- For [offline inference](../serving/offline_inference.md), they are part of the arguments to [LLM][vllm.LLM] class.
- For [online serving](../serving/openai_compatible_server.md), they are part of the arguments to `vllm serve`.
You can look at [EngineArgs][vllm.engine.arg_utils.EngineArgs] and [AsyncEngineArgs][vllm.engine.arg_utils.AsyncEngineArgs] to see the available engine arguments.
The engine argument classes, [EngineArgs][vllm.engine.arg_utils.EngineArgs] and [AsyncEngineArgs][vllm.engine.arg_utils.AsyncEngineArgs], are a combination of the configuration classes defined in [vllm.config][]. Therefore, if you are interested in developer documentation, we recommend looking at these configuration classes as they are the source of truth for types, defaults and docstrings.

# SPDX-License-Identifier: Apache-2.0
# SPDX-FileCopyrightText: Copyright contributors to the vLLM project
import logging
import sys
from argparse import SUPPRESS, HelpFormatter
from pathlib import Path
from typing import Literal
from unittest.mock import MagicMock, patch
ROOT_DIR = Path(__file__).parent.parent.parent.parent
ARGPARSE_DOC_DIR = ROOT_DIR / "docs/argparse"
sys.path.insert(0, str(ROOT_DIR))
sys.modules["aiohttp"] = MagicMock()
sys.modules["blake3"] = MagicMock()
sys.modules["vllm._C"] = MagicMock()
from vllm.engine.arg_utils import AsyncEngineArgs, EngineArgs # noqa: E402
from vllm.utils import FlexibleArgumentParser # noqa: E402
logger = logging.getLogger("mkdocs")
class MarkdownFormatter(HelpFormatter):
"""Custom formatter that generates markdown for argument groups."""
def __init__(self, prog):
super().__init__(prog,
max_help_position=float('inf'),
width=float('inf'))
self._markdown_output = []
def start_section(self, heading):
if heading not in {"positional arguments", "options"}:
self._markdown_output.append(f"\n### {heading}\n\n")
def end_section(self):
pass
def add_text(self, text):
if text:
self._markdown_output.append(f"{text.strip()}\n\n")
def add_usage(self, usage, actions, groups, prefix=None):
pass
def add_arguments(self, actions):
for action in actions:
option_strings = f'`{"`, `".join(action.option_strings)}`'
self._markdown_output.append(f"#### {option_strings}\n\n")
if choices := action.choices:
choices = f'`{"`, `".join(str(c) for c in choices)}`'
self._markdown_output.append(
f"Possible choices: {choices}\n\n")
self._markdown_output.append(f"{action.help}\n\n")
if (default := action.default) != SUPPRESS:
self._markdown_output.append(f"Default: `{default}`\n\n")
def format_help(self):
"""Return the formatted help as markdown."""
return "".join(self._markdown_output)
def create_parser(cls, **kwargs) -> FlexibleArgumentParser:
"""Create a parser for the given class with markdown formatting.
Args:
cls: The class to create a parser for
**kwargs: Additional keyword arguments to pass to `cls.add_cli_args`.
Returns:
FlexibleArgumentParser: A parser with markdown formatting for the class.
"""
parser = FlexibleArgumentParser()
parser.formatter_class = MarkdownFormatter
with patch("vllm.config.DeviceConfig.__post_init__"):
return cls.add_cli_args(parser, **kwargs)
def on_startup(command: Literal["build", "gh-deploy", "serve"], dirty: bool):
logger.info("Generating argparse documentation")
logger.debug("Root directory: %s", ROOT_DIR.resolve())
logger.debug("Output directory: %s", ARGPARSE_DOC_DIR.resolve())
# Create the ARGPARSE_DOC_DIR if it doesn't exist
if not ARGPARSE_DOC_DIR.exists():
ARGPARSE_DOC_DIR.mkdir(parents=True)
# Create parsers to document
parsers = {
"engine_args": create_parser(EngineArgs),
"async_engine_args": create_parser(AsyncEngineArgs,
async_args_only=True),
}
# Generate documentation for each parser
for stem, parser in parsers.items():
doc_path = ARGPARSE_DOC_DIR / f"{stem}.md"
with open(doc_path, "w") as f:
f.write(parser.format_help())
logger.info("Argparse generated: %s", doc_path.relative_to(ROOT_DIR))
